Significance

Mauni Amavasya is observed in complete silence (mauna) for purification of mind and speech. It is the most auspicious day for holy bathing at Prayagraj during the Magh Mela and Kumbh Mela.

Why does the date of Mauni Amavasya change every year?

Mauni Amavasya is fixed by the Hindu luni-solar calendar — it falls on amavasya of magha — observed in silence, holy bathing day. Because that tithi drifts against the Gregorian calendar each year, the English date moves, even though the festival is always on the same point in the lunar month.
